About this House

From the expansive views, natural landscaping, and beautiful location, to the open, functional floor plan with a fully finished walk out basement, this rural retreat encompasses Wyoming living from the outside in. Inviting covered front patio opens into a well-lit entry that flows seamlessly into a spacious living area, complete with a custom fireplace, perfect to cozy up to anytime of day. Farm style kitchen is drenched in natural light, and offers ample counter space, cabinet storage, island space AND a generous butlers pantry, perfect for all those small appliances, and a prep station for entertaining! Step onto the covered back deck for additional entertaining space, or a peaceful space for morning coffee (wired for surround sound!). A little R&R goes a long way in the primary suite, with spa like finishes and comfortable design choices that create a welcoming space to start each day. Additionally, this home is completely finished, to include a spacious family room (tons of windows!!!), walk in vault, and more. 30x30 shop to house the toys and extras- concrete floors and electric already installed! Welcome home- all you need to do is bring yourself!!!!
753 N Table Mountain Loop, Cheyenne, WY 82009 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 3,318 sqft single-family home built in 2024. It last sold for $735,000 on Oct 17, 2025 (1% below the $739,000 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$756,800, with a rent estimate of $3,800/month.
